    I kept the default SNES party of Cecil, Kain, Edge, Rosa and Rydia for my first time through the final dungeon in FFIVA. I'm not sure if I should have replaced Kain with Yang because his Jump is very slow in FFIVA (although it still protects Kain from attacks sometimes), and he doesn't cause as much damage with his spear alone. Meanwhile, Yang's attacks are quite powerful. However, I just can't imagine the final battle, its dialogues and the aftermath with a different party.

    i liked edge, with two boomerangs, you can put him on the back row so his attack is reasonably high and his defense is great. plus he always gets critical hits against flying enemies this way.

    i wanted to swap kain for yang but i thought it'd be best to finish the game with the most primary characters. i eneded up finishing it with all the others anyway to open up their trials.
